Russell Gene Chesnut, known affectionately as Russ to his family and friends, passed away peacefully on September 5, 2025, in Summerfield, Florida. Born on March 2, 1964, in Hamilton, Ohio, Russ’s journey through life was marked by his unwavering kindness, his love for his family, and his dedication to serving others.

Russ is survived by his loving wife, Karrie, and their children, Rusty Chesnut, Loren and Matthew Womack. His legacy continues through his cherished grandchildren, Jayci, Lathan, Matson, Leanna, Luella, Alayna Womack, Saylor Rayne Chesnut, and Rylyn May Arnold. He also leaves behind his siblings, Gilbert, Jackie, William, Randy, Mitchell, and Jamie, along with a host of nieces, nephews, and a community of friends who deeply felt his generosity and warmth. Russ was preceded in death by his son, Trinnen James.
